A few days later, someone came to Marquis Starr’s residence.
Unaware, Emily went out to the garden to gather flowers for a vase. She collected the stems of various flowers, including lisianthus, anemones, dahlias, and didiscus. After trying different combinations she finally achieved a satisfactory arrangement. A bright smile couldn’t help but appear on Emily’s face.
Crown Prince Lucius, holding a bouquet of flowers, approached Emily and witnessed the scene, causing him to drop the flowers onto the ground. In front of Emily’s smile, everything he had prepared seemed inadequate. Alvin, the butler, observed Lucius’s dazed state and walked over to Emily to deliver the news.
“Madam, His Highness the Crown Prince has arrived.”
“You mean Prince Lucius?”
Emily’s eyes widened in surprise. When she turned around, the prince was indeed standing shyly, waving his hand in greeting.
“You didn’t know? He came after receiving your invitation…”
Emily shouted in a low voice that Lucius couldn’t hear.
“How would I know and even invite the crown prince?”
“What? So you’re saying His Highness lied?”
Emily pressed her temple as if she had a headache.
“Since the guest has arrived, bring some tea.”
“Yes, understood.”
Alvin nodded with an uneasy expression. Emily struggled to put a smile on her face and bowed toward Lucius. After receiving her greeting, Lucius slowly approached Emily. As Lucius approached slowly his face looked very familiar to Emily.
“Hmm, have we met somewhere?”
Emily blurted out and immediately regretted it. It sounded like a cheesy pick-up line.
But after hearing Emily’s words, Lucius smiled deeply. He was overjoyed that she remembered him.
“We met at a banquet. On the stairs to the garden side of the imperial palace.”
At his words, Emily’s memory suddenly returned, and her face turned pale.
“Oh, my apologies, I didn’t know it was Your Highness. I thought you were just… a somewhat unfortunate young man.”
Back then, she thought Lucius was a handsome, but unfortunate young man with a slightly loose screw.
“I should be the one apologizing, not you.”
They exchanged words as they sat at a tea table set up in the greenhouse. Alvin quickly arranged the refreshments and left very slowly when he walked away. Before Alvin left, he sent a signal to Emily with his gaze.
‘Should I leave altogether, or should I stand here as background?’
‘Just go.’
Emily subtly shook her head in response to the signal. Even Lucius seemed enchanted by her every move.
Unlike when they met at the party, Emily had her hair loosely tied to one side and wore a light dress. Her innocent face, with almost no makeup, glowed white, resembling an angel from a fairy tale.
After confirming that Alvin had left, Emily opened her mouth.
“Ahem, but Your Highness, you said you received my invitation.”
Lucius, who regained his composure at Emily’s voice, responded with bewildered expression.
“Yes, didn’t you reply to my letter?”
“You wrote me a letter?”
At Emily’s surprised reaction, Lucius realized that something was wrong.
“Someone must have played a joke.”
“Hmm, what a strange prank. Could I possibly find out the contents of the letter Your Highness sent me?”
At those words, Lucius blushed. It seemed that he had only thought about expressing those thoughts internally and never expected to have to say them out loud.
‘Even though I have no idea what kind of person you are, I fell in love with you at first sight. I want to have a deeper conversation with you.’
